Oklahoma has for a long time been interrelated with Bingo. That’s owing to the fact that the Native tribes of Oklahoma have provided Bingo games for ages. Patrons from every one of the nearby states get in vehicles and travel into Oklahoma to gamble on Bingo on the weekends.

The 1988 IGRA became law after a benchmark determination by The U.S. Supreme Court the year before. Since that time, twenty three of the thirty nine Indian tribes located in Oklahoma have opened gambling halls. The Chickasaw were the 1st Oklahoma Native tribes to take advantage of the wagering laws, and today control 10 gambling dens of their own. Bingo was the game on which these gambling dens were founded. computerized games such as slots were not approved, on the grounds that they are believed to contribute to gambling dependency at a higher rate than bingo.

In recent years, Oklahoma governing edicts has changed to allow for large Amerindian betting gambling halls. You’ll now discover American Indian gambling halls with slots, video poker and blackjack tables. Craps and roulette are not approved in the Native gambling halls as of yet, although this is only a waiting game. No one can say what having other gambling hall games in the bingo parlours will do for the popularity of bingo.
